Hydrocortisone remains a frontline option against inflammation, allergic reactions, and adrenal insufficiency in animal patients. No two formulations react the same way to raw API characteristics. Manufacturers serving equine medicine, for example, often require more rapid dissolution for emergency steroid injection, while oral tablets for small animals depend on compressible, flowable powder. Large livestock practice shifts to medicated premixes and in-feed designs, calling for evenly dispersing hydrocortisone that prevents hot spots or sedimentation through months of warehouse storage.
